Elected fellow of Russian academy

Special Correspondent

BANGALORE: Bangalore's scientists and academicians are frequently in the news and often for all the right reasons.

Goverdhan Mehta, CSIR Bhatnagar Fellow at the Indian Institute of Science and Chairman, National Assessment and Accreditation Council (NAAC), has been elected Fellow of the Russian Academy of Sciences for his research in chemical sciences.

The Russian academy is more than 200 years old.

Prof. Mehta is a former director of the IISc. and president of the Indian National Science Academy.

He is currently president of the Paris-based International Council for Science.
